Ease of use is the top consideration for B2B firms when evaluating new customer relationship management solutions, according to recent research from Insightly and Ascend2. Price and ability to integrate with existing systems were ranked second and third, respectively. Improving workflows/processes is the top motivation for shopping for a new solution.
Salespeople cite sales forecasting as the most essential CRM feature for their job, while marketers say dashboard views is the most essential feature. The most significant challenges to implementing a new CRM are training time (43%) and integration with existing systems (40%).
The report was based on data from a survey conducted in April 2022 among 500 sales, marketing, customer success, and operations professionals who work for B2B organizations in the US with between 50 and 500 employees.
